The Boy Scout And Other Stories For Boys tells the story of a dedicated young boy who exemplifies the virtues of personal sacrifice and kindness through his involvement in the Boy Scouts. The narrative centers around his commitment to the Scout motto of performing a good turn daily, as he embarks on an adventure to attend a camp. Throughout his journey, the boy shows unwavering dedication to helping others selflessly, refusing any easy shortcuts, such as accepting a ride from a wealthy stranger, because it would not involve true sacrifice. His actions inspire others, spreading a ripple of altruism and showing the impact of simple yet meaningful deeds. The novella highlights the importance of living with integrity, making decisions based on values, and performing acts of kindness even in the face of personal difficulty. The story encourages the idea that even small acts of goodness can lead to broader positive consequences, reminding readers of the significance of selflessness and the power of doing the right thing for the sake of others.
